Yellow alert given for the Nazaré Challenge
Natxo and Axi are getting ready; Friday, November 16th looks good for the launch of the first stage of the 2018/2019 big wave tour
The Nazaré Challenge is on yellow alert, the WSL announced recently on social media and in a press release. According to them, a powerful swell is heading to Praia do Norte and this Friday the wind conditions look good for a big and perfect break.
As a rule, the green light must be given 48 hours in advance, in the following hours confirmation should come or return to waiting.
Basque surfer Natxo González, who qualified for the tour last year, will be in the tournament and his neighbour, Axi Muniain, who has already acted as a rescuer, appears among the substitutes.
